Forbestcuttingperformance,grass over6 inchesinheightshouldbe mowedtwice.Makethefirst cut

relativelyhigh;the secondto desired height.

TO ADJUST GAUGE WHEELS

Gauge wheels are propedyadjusted when they are slightlyoffthe ground when moweris at the desired cutting height in operatingposition.Gauge wheels then keep the deck in prober positionto help preventscalpingin most terrain conditions.

NOTE: Adjustgaugewheels with tractor on a flat level surface.

1.Adjust mowerto desiredcuttingheight (See TO ADJUST MOWER CUTTING

HEIGHT" in the Operationsectionof this manual).

2.With mower in desiredheight of cut position,gauge wheels shouldbe assembledso they are slightlyoff the ground.Installgauge wheel in appropdatehole with shoulderbolt, 3/8 washer, and 3/8-16Iocknutand tighten securely.

3.Repeat for oppositeside installing

gauge wheel in same adjustment hole.

TO OPERATE MOWER

Your tractor is equipped with an operator presence sensing switch. Any attempt by the operator to leave the seat with the engine running and the attachment clutch engaged will shut off the engine.

1.Select desired height of cut.

2.Start mower blades by engaging attachment clutch control.

TO STOP MOWER BLADES - disengage attachment clutch control.

_, CAUTION: Do not operate the

mower without either the entire grass catcher, on mowers so equipped, or the deflector shield in place.

TO OPERATE ON HILLS

_CAUTION: Do not ddve up or down hills with slopes greater than 15 ° and do not ddve across any slope.

Choose the slowest speed before starting up or down hills.

Avoid stopping or changing speed on hills.

If slowing is necessary, move throttle control lever to slower position.

If stopping is absolutely necessary, push clutch/breke pedal quickly to brake position and engage parking brake.

Move motion control lever to neutral (N) position.

IMPORTANT: The motion control lever does not return to neutral (N) position when the clutch/brake pedal is de- pressed.

To restart movement, slowly release parking brake and clutch/brake pedal.

Slowly move motion control lever to slowest setting.

Make all turns slowly.

TO TRANSPORT

When pushing or towing your tractor, be sure to disengage transmission by placing freewheel control in freewheeling position. Free wheel control is located at the rear drawbar of tractor.

1.Raise attachment lift to highest position with attachment lift control.

2.Pull freewheel control out and down into the slot and release so it is held in

the disengaged position.

Do not push or tow tractor at more than two (2) MPH.

To reengaga transmission, reverse above procedure.
